Output 59ecbb3c817fbabe86a8848278b8f00698ddda2803986103c3ecd13ae34104da:1

value
7990861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 749a0b041bdf435e3d21300919ccd9da6810b17e OP_EQUAL
address
3CKYqtn94oEQgrNeaMKkSP9DDddwJLvA6L
transaction
59ecbb3c817fbabe86a8848278b8f00698ddda2803986103c3ecd13ae34104da
spent
true